An Overseas Citizenship of India (OCI) card sits atop India Rupee banknotes in Toronto, Ontario, Canada, on January 01, 2026. Overseas Citizenship of India (OCI) is a form of permanent residency available to people of Indian origin, allowing them to live and work in India indefinitely. Despite its name, OCI is not recognized as citizenship by the Republic of India or by the vast majority of nations worldwide, and it does not grant the right to vote in Indian elections or hold public office. As of 2022, there are over 4 million holders of OCI cards among the Indian diaspora.
